wsdl2h是gSoap安装后的工具,用于将wsdl文件按照typemap.dat映射到c/c++类型,官话:wsdl2h 工具需要一个typemap.dat文件来将 XSD 模式类型映射到 C/C++ 类型,并将 XML 命名空间前缀绑定到要在项目中使用的短名称。 这个typemap.dat用来帮助映射的文件gSoap源码中...
步骤五:使用wsdl生成onvif.h头文件 wsdl2h -o onvif.h -c -s -t ./typemap.dat devicemgmt.wsdl event.wsdl 1. 步骤六:找不到xsd文件,官网也有下载 下载该文件还得处理路径,直接将命令改为网址的,如下图: wsdl2h -o onvif.h -c -s -t ./typemap.dat \ https://www.onvif.org/profiles/specific...
- 编译器:ONVIF协议的源代码需要使用C语言编写,因此需要一个支持C语言编译的编译器,如GCC或Clang。 - 构建工具:ONVIF协议的源代码通常使用CMake进行构建,因此需要安装CMake工具。 编译步骤 下面是编译ONVIF协议的详细步骤: 步骤一:获取源代码 首先,从官方网站或相关开源项目的代码库中获取ONVIF协议的源代码。可以...
Profile C应用于电子门禁系统。Profile C设备和客户应支持站点信息、门禁控制、事件和报警管理。 1.5.4 Profile Q 快银——Profile Q凭借着出色的超速度,应用于快速安装领域: 简单的设置 发现、配置和控制设备 先进的安全功能 Profile Q应用于网络视频系统,其目的是提供Profile Q产品的快速发现和配置(例如:网络摄像机...
2013_12_ONVIF标准Profile协议C_规范_v1-0.pdf,ONVIF™ – 1 – ONVIF Profile C Specification – Ver. 1.0 ONVIF Profile C Specification Version 1.0 December 2013 ONVIF™ – 2 – ONVIF Profile C Specification – Ver. 1.0 2008-2013 by ONVIF: Open Netw
ONVIF(开放网络视频接口论坛)是一个全球性的开放标准组织,致力于促进网络视频在安防监控领域的互通性与标准化。ONVIF规范的目标是实现不同品牌、不同平台、不同技术之间的互通性,降低网络视频监控系统的复杂性,并提高系统的可靠性、灵活性和可扩展性。 二、ONVIF协议格式基础 ONVIF基于WSDL(网络服务描述语言)和XML(可...
ONVIF协议利用Web Service的HTTP/SOAP接口,通过WSDL描述服务接口,SOAP消息结构来实现设备间的通信。例如,Profile C中的电子门禁管理,Profile Q的快速安装和设备配置安全通信,以及Profile A的访问控制规则管理,都是其具体应用实例。在实际操作中,开发者可以使用诸如C/C++, Python, Java, Go等语言库来...
1、c语言开发onvif 1) onvif server ONVIF Device(IP camera) Service server (Linux daemon) This server (Service) has a minimal implementation. Use this server as a template for writing your ONVIF service for an IP camera. https://github.com/KoynovStas/onvif_srvd ...
ONVIF协议,全称是Open Network Video Interface Forum,即开放型网络视频接口论坛。它最初是由安讯士、博世、索尼等三家公司在2008年共同成立的一个国际性开放型网络视频产品标准网络接口的开发论坛。后来,这个技术开发论坛共同制定的开放性行业标准,就用了该论坛名称的大写字母来命名,即ONVIF网络视频标准规范,简称ONVIF协...
ONVIF(Open Network Video Interface Forum)协议是一个开放的网络视频接口论坛,致力于促进网络视频设备之间的互操作性。它提供了一个标准的接口,使不同厂商的设备能够无缝地互相交流和集成。ONVIF协议的目标是实现网络视频设备之间的互联互通,提供更好的用户体验。 ONVIF协议的主要特点之一是它是一个开放的标准。任何厂商...